Workers (or their representative) have the right to file a confidential report about injuries, safety issues, and actions taken against them for speaking up including being fired, demoted, or disciplined. You have the right to file both complaints if appropriate. Remember, employers are required to follow safety laws and keep you safe. Employers must also maintain a workplace free from retaliation for voicing concerns about hazards or violations of federal law. This provides information on filing reports with the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A)
